Frost Update: New Player Roles and Refined Gameplay Enhance Tactical Depth in FC 25
The Frost Update brings two new player roles to FC IQ, enhancing tactical options:
- Classic 10: A traditional attacking midfielder who directs offensive plays.
- Wide Half: A defensive player responsible for covering wide areas while supporting build-up play.
These new roles add more variety and depth to team strategies. Additionally, gameplay mechanics have been refined with smoother and more responsive skill moves like Stop and Turn, Drag Back, and Fake Shots, making matches feel more fluid and engaging.
Shorter Rush Matches & Improved Idle Detection in FC 25 Ultimate Team and Clubs
One major update is the shortened Rush match duration, reduced from 7 minutes to 5 minutes. EA found that most games are decided by the 5th minute, so this change speeds up gameplay for a faster, more intense experience.
Another key improvement addresses idling. A new detection system now identifies and warns inactive players, removing them if necessary. It also considers pauses and other inactivity, ensuring that both Rush and Ultimate Team matches stay fair and competitive.
First Frost Career Mode Update
The latest Career Mode update brings exciting improvements to youth development and player progression. Based on player feedback, EA has enhanced PlayStyle progression for young goalkeepers. Now, GK prospects with an 80 OVR can upgrade one PlayStyle to PlayStyle+. Those with 90+ potential and four PlayStyles can earn two PlayStyles+: the first at 80 OVR and the second at 90 OVR. This system also applies to non-academy players, who will receive a PlayStyle+ at 90 OVR. However, players at the end of their careers will lose PlayStyle+ if their OVR drops below 75, keeping progression realistic and balanced.
Additionally, Player Career Mode now includes a new set of iconic players. Fans can add legends like Pelé, Camille Abily, Kaká, Juan Román Riquelme, and Franck Ribéry to their teams, bringing a blend of history and star power. These updates make Career Mode more dynamic, rewarding, and tactically rich.
First Frost Clubs Update: Double XP Events and new 3-star Facilities
The First Frost Update introduces exciting new features to Clubs, including Double XP Events that allow players to earn XP at an accelerated rate. During these events, the 2x XP multiplier will be clearly displayed in the user interface, so players know when it's active. XP earned will still depend on match performance, with higher ratings leading to faster progression.
Additionally, the update adds two new 3-star Facilities—VR Room and Passing Drill. These new options expand the range of Facility combinations available to managers, offering more ways to enhance player attributes. The VR Room focuses on improving Finishing and Short Passing with a Long Throw PlayStyle, while the Passing Drill boosts Long Passing and Intercept with an Intercept PlayStyle. These additions provide more strategic choices for club management and player development.
First Frost new winter menu theme
The Frost Update adds a festive touch to the game with snowy visuals in training drills and live matches, creating a winter wonderland feel.
In FC 25 Ultimate Team, EA introduces 101 new player items, including stars like David de Gea, Mats Hummels, and Alexis Sánchez. These updates refresh the roster and improve gameplay with upgraded stats for several players, adding more variety.
Additionally, FC Ultimate Team now features a Max Tactics mode for live friendlies, which focuses on strategic gameplay. In this mode, players who are moved to different positions will receive stat boosts, shown as Player Plus+ items, offering more tactical options for your team.
